About the Event

APSCON / APSCON Unmanned is the flagship annual gathering for the airborne public safety community. The official organizer describes the 2026 edition as a combined manned and unmanned aviation education and networking event with a shared exhibit hall, bringing together public safety aviation professionals, service providers, and mission-critical technology suppliers in one location.

This event matters because it sits at the intersection of public safety operations, aviation readiness, procurement, training, maintenance, and emerging unmanned systems adoption. It is especially relevant for agencies and vendors involved in law enforcement aviation, fire service aviation, EMS aviation, UAS operations, communications, mission management, aircraft maintenance, and specialized public safety equipment sourcing.
